Pulmonary Sarcoidosis: XTMAB-16 Treatment Study

We are testing a new treatment called XTMAB-16 for people with pulmonary sarcoidosis to see if it can safely reduce the need for corticosteroids. This study will help determine the best dose and assess its effectiveness.

Prednisolone
Prednisolone is a steroid substance that reduces inflammation and suppresses an overactive immune response.
Prednisolone Sodium Phosphate
Prednisolone sodium phosphate is a corticosteroid that reduces inflammation and suppresses the immune system for allergic and inflammatory conditions.
